We’re proud of our heritage and the team that drives our success. Now, we’re looking for an experienced and people-focused Production Manager to join our Tubes Operations team at Hartlepool and help shape the future of our 20” Mill.
At Tata Steel, the Hartlepool 20” Mill is a key part of our UK Tubes operations, producing over 200,000 tonnes of tubular products for the construction and energy sectors. This role offers a great opportunity to step into a pivotal leadership role, influencing performance, safety and future investment in a fast-paced industrial setting.

WHAT YOU WILL DO
In this role, you’ll lead the daily operations of a key production area at the 20” Mill. Your focus will be on delivering safely, efficiently, and to customer requirements – but just as important will be how you motivate, coach, and engage the team around you.
You’ll oversee all aspects of shift and area management, planning production to meet schedule targets and applying your leadership skills to deliver productivity, quality and cost objectives. You’ll play a key part in performance improvement, people development, and driving cultural change.
